Unauthenticated telemetry disclosure via disabled AutoSupport transmission
Published Aug 25, 2022 · Updated Aug 3, 2024
Information disclosure in NetApp Active IQ Unified Manager before 9.10P1 allows remote attackers to obtain storage-management telemetry. The AutoSupport subsystem continues sending cluster, node, and Unified Manager data to Active IQ after periodic AutoSupport is disabled. No authentication or user interaction is required, but network egress to Active IQ must remain available; exposure is limited to information contained in the transmitted telemetry.
